Activities and local experiences around Lucino and Lake Como
Family days in Lucino and the surrounding Lake Como region can revolve around a mix of gentle outdoor adventures, cultural experiences, and delicious Italian cuisine. Here are some ideas designed for safety, enjoyment, and convenience:
- Boat trips across Lake Como: Regular ferries connect Como, Bellagio, Varenna, Menaggio, and many small villages. A calm morning cruise gives kids a chance to spot waterfalls, villas, and lush gardens from the water, while adults savor the dramatic scenery and lakeside villas.
- Exploring lakeside towns: Short walks along promenades, child-friendly playgrounds, and gelato stops in towns like Cernobbio or Moltrasio are perfect for a gentle pace. The area’s pathways are generally well-maintained, with benches and shade where families can pause for a snack break.
- Villa visits and gardens: Villa Carlotta in Tremezzo and Villa del Balbianello offer lush lawns, terraced gardens, and picturesque views. While some areas of these grand properties may have restricted access for safety, many family-friendly tours and shorter trails make it easy to enjoy the scenery with children in tow.
- Greenways and light hiking: The Greenway del Lago di Como is a scenic route that links villages with relatively flat, well-marked paths. It’s ideal for families with strollers or little hikers who want a scenic day without strenuous climbs.
- Water activities: Kayaking, stand-up paddleboarding, and gentle swims in designated lake areas provide a safe way to enjoy the water. Look for rentals that offer life jackets for all ages and brief safety instructions before you enter the water.
- Local markets and cuisine: Fresh produce markets and family-friendly trattorie offer a taste of Lombard cuisine—risotto, polenta, freshwater fish, and seasonal vegetables. Many eateries welcome children and offer simpler menu options or child-sized portions.
- Cultural experiences: Duomo di Como and nearby historical sites provide a window into Lombard heritage. Short, engaging tours or kid-friendly audio guides can help young explorers stay engaged during cultural visits.
- Seasonal festivals and events: Depending on the time of year, you’ll find local fairs, harvest celebrations, or seasonal tastings that feature regional cheeses, wines, and olive oils. These experiences can be both educational and delicious for families.

Seasonal planning: what to expect and how to pack
Lucino and the Lake Como region experience four distinct seasons, each with its own family-friendly opportunities. Here are practical packing and planning tips to help you tailor your vacation to the season:
- Spring (April–June): Cool mornings with warm afternoons. Bring layers, light rain jackets, and comfortable walking shoes. This is a fantastic time for stroller-friendly strolls along the lakeside, park picnics, and early-season boat rides when crowds are lighter.
- Summer (July–August): Warm days with plenty of sunshine. Pack sun hats, sunscreen, swimsuits, and water-friendly footwear. Reserve family-friendly rental accommodations early, particularly yurts that may have popular dates. Morning lake activities and late-afternoon walks are ideal to avoid peak heat.
- Autumn (September–October): Mild weather and fewer crowds. Great for scenic hikes and wine or olive oil tastings in nearby villages. A lightweight jacket and extra layers are wise, especially in the evenings near the lake.
- Winter (November–March): Colder temperatures and the potential for snowfall in the Alps. If you stay in a yurt with heating, enjoy cozy evenings by a fire pit or inside a well-insulated dormitory-style space. Check local opening hours for lakefront paths and museums, which may vary by season.
